icinga-report+jasperserver+icinga-web安装步骤

本文涉及的产品
云数据库 RDS MySQL,集群系列 2核4GB
推荐场景:
搭建个人博客
RDS MySQL Serverless 基础系列,0.5-2RCU 50GB
云数据库 RDS MySQL,高可用系列 2核4GB
简介:

icinga-report+jasperserver+icinga-web安装步骤:


已安装过icinga,步骤略




jaserserver:



# wget http://downloads.sourceforge.net/project/jasperserver/JasperServer/JasperReports


%20Server%20Community%20Edition%205.6.0/jasperreports-server-cp-5.6.0-linux-x64-installer.run


# chmod +x jasperreports-server-cp-5.6.0-linux-x64-installer.run


# ./jasperreports-server-cp-5.6.0-linux-x64-installer.run


一路默认回车即可


# /opt/jasperreports-server-cp-5.6.0/ctlscript.sh start



icinga-report:



# wget http://sourceforge.net/projects/icinga/files/icinga-reporting/1.9.0/icinga-reports-


1.9.0.tar.gz


# tar zxfv icinga-reports-1.9.0.tar.gz


# cd icinga-reports-1.9.0


# ./configure --with-jasper-server=/opt/jasperreports-server-cp-5.6.0


# make 


# make install

(如果出现build.xml does not exist可执行下面两步,如果没出现可跳过下面两步)


# cd /opt/jasperreports-server-cp-5.6.0/buildomatic/


#  ./js-import.sh --input-zip /root/icinga-reports-1.9.0/reports/icinga/package/js-icinga-


reports.zip


# /opt/jasperreports-server-cp-5.6.0/ctlscript.sh stop


# /opt/jasperreports-server-cp-5.6.0/ctlscript.sh start



http://ip:8080/jasperserver —用户名:jasperadmin  密码:japseradmin—root——Icinga——Data Sources——IDO——编辑——


jdbc:mysql://localhost:3306/icinga   用户名:idouser  密码:123456(视前面安装icinga而定)——


测试连接(连接成功)——保存





icinga-web:



http://archive.ubuntu.com/ubuntu/pool/universe/i/icinga-web/icinga-web_1.13.1-1_all.deb


# dpkg -i icinga-web_1.13.1-1_all.deb


第1次输的是root的密码(该root是指mysql的root)

第2次设的是icinga_web账号的密码

第1次设的是root的密码(该root是指登录页面的root)


# mysql -u root -p'123456'


> use mysql;

> grant all on icinga.* to icinga@localhost identified by 'icinga';   (此处必须是icinga和


icinga,和之前搭建icinga账号无关)

> flush privileges;


# cd /etc/icinga-web/conf.d/


# vi module_reporting.xml


<module enabled="true">   (默认为false)


:wq


# vi cronks.xml (找到icingaReportingDefault部分)


<ae parameter name="hide">false</ae parameter>

<ae parameter name="enabled">true</ae parameter>


:wq


# /usr/lib/icinga-web/bin/clearcache.sh



访问:http://ip/icinga-web   用户名:root  密码:123456(即上面设的密码)在左侧有个Reporting项(


通过该处即可查看jasperserver的icinga内容)

本文转自linux博客51CTO博客,原文链接http://blog.51cto.com/yangzhiming/1685908如需转载请自行联系原作者


yangzhimingg

相关实践学习
如何在云端创建MySQL数据库
开始实验后,系统会自动创建一台自建MySQL的 源数据库 ECS 实例和一台 目标数据库 RDS。
全面了解阿里云能为你做什么
阿里云在全球各地部署高效节能的绿色数据中心,利用清洁计算为万物互联的新世界提供源源不断的能源动力,目前开服的区域包括中国(华北、华东、华南、香港)、新加坡、美国(美东、美西)、欧洲、中东、澳大利亚、日本。目前阿里云的产品涵盖弹性计算、数据库、存储与CDN、分析与搜索、云通信、网络、管理与监控、应用服务、互联网中间件、移动服务、视频服务等。通过本课程,来了解阿里云能够为你的业务带来哪些帮助 &nbsp; &nbsp; 相关的阿里云产品:云服务器ECS 云服务器 ECS(Elastic Compute Service)是一种弹性可伸缩的计算服务,助您降低 IT 成本,提升运维效率,使您更专注于核心业务创新。产品详情: https://www.aliyun.com/product/ecs
相关文章
|
2月前
|
前端开发 安全 JavaScript
构建高效Web应用的五个关键步骤
【9月更文挑战第21天】本文将引导读者通过五个核心步骤来构建一个高效的Web应用。我们将从选择合适的技术栈开始,到实现响应式设计、优化性能、保证安全性,最后确保可维护性和扩展性。每个步骤都配备了具体的代码示例,帮助理解如何在实践中应用这些概念。
|
6月前
|
存储 缓存 监控
Web 应用程序性能测试核心步骤
Web 应用程序性能测试核心步骤
|
搜索推荐 UED
Web Accessibility(Web A11y):构建包容性网络的关键步骤
Web无障碍性(Web Accessibility,简称Web A11y)是一项旨在确保网站和应用程序能够让所有人,包括残障人士,都能轻松访问和使用的关键实践。本博客将深入探讨Web无障碍性的概念、重要性以及如何在您的项目中实施无障碍设计的关键步骤。
131 0
|
1月前
|
SQL 前端开发 测试技术
进行Web应用的设计需要遵循一定的步骤和原则
【10月更文挑战第3天】进行Web应用的设计需要遵循一定的步骤和原则
24 3
|
3月前
|
测试技术 Shell 数据库
Django视图测试:构建可靠Web应用的关键步骤
Django视图测试:构建可靠Web应用的关键步骤
30 0
|
5月前
|
XML JSON API
RESTful API关键部分组成和构建web应用程序步骤
RESTful API关键部分组成和构建web应用程序步骤
37 0
|
自然语言处理 安全
Web3.0钱包系统开发(开发功能)/指南教程/步骤流程/方案设计/项目逻辑/规则玩法/案例源码
Wallet type selection: Determine the type of wallet, which can be a browser plugin wallet, mobile application wallet, or online web wallet. The choice of wallet type should be based on the target user group and usage environment.
|
弹性计算 安全 Java
关于如何将Web项目部署到阿里云ecs服务器-5个步骤搞定
关于如何将Web项目部署到阿里云ecs服务器-5个步骤搞定
关于如何将Web项目部署到阿里云ecs服务器-5个步骤搞定
|
JavaScript 前端开发 Java
44【Java生态前后端】开发web应用使用到的技术 & Vue框架+Java开发Web应用的步骤
使用Vue框架进行前端开发,实现应用的交互和界面展示。
311 1
|
Java 关系型数据库 MySQL
linux云服务器下运行web项目完整步骤
linux云服务器下运行web项目完整步骤
下一篇
无影云桌面